Hypha request ASN's from ARIN on behalf of TCN #329

ARIN responded about registering for OrgID which we need to send more information to them but since business lookup in Ontario database is behind paid services I sent them a screenshot of the HST number record and link to where they can find the record. I hope they will accept that. |

ARIN accepted our OrgID request next step is to drift a ticket for a quote on pricing. |
You can probably gather enough info to put together a request from tomeshnet/toronto-community-network#20 |
I have confirmed with ARIN: First year $550 for AS + $500 2X-Small (up to and including /22 and up to and including /36) Annually is $500 2X-Small which covers the ASN fee. |

We are at the stage of applying for the ASN but before that we need to figure out what to put into the application such as start date and peers. We will discuss this in tomesh network meeting. |
We submitted requests for /23 IPv4 and ASN to ARIN and waiting for reply. |
Ask @hyphacoop/operations-wg to review contract then @hyphacoop/finance-wg can pay |
We got the ASN approval from ARIN. |
